Apply dns(Open dns) to a particular range of ips and Google dns for the rest
-
I need help to apply a certain dns to a range of ips,because we are using Open DNS to block certain web sites and would like to set this only for this range of ips.
Ex: 192.168.1.1-192.168.1.235 - BLOCKED
192.168.1.235 to 255 - ALLOWED
-
You can't set DNS with DHCP like that in 1.2.3 or 2.0. You can only set those options differently if those clients are on a different interface+subnet.
Besides, if someone were smart enough they could just change their DNS servers manually to the other one you allow, and get around that restriction.
When you setup a restriction like OpenDNS you must also set rules on that interface that prevent the users from talking to any other DNS servers.
